The aseptic collection of blood cultures requires that the skin be cleansed with: - Answer✔70%
alcohol and 2% iodine or an iodophor.
When cleansing the skin with alcohol and then iodine for the collection of a blood culture, the
iodine (or iodophor) should remain intact on the skin for at least: - Answer✔60 seconds
What is the purpose of adding 0.025% to 0.050% sodium polyanetholsulfonate (SPS) to nutrient
broth media for the collection of blood cultures? - Answer✔It inhibits phagocytosis and
complement
A flexible calcium alginate nasopharyngeal swab is the collection device of choice for recovery
of which organism from the nasopharynx? - Answer✔Corynebacterium diphtheriae
Semisolid transport media such as Amies, Stuart, or Cary-Blair are suitable for the transport of
swabs for culture of most pathogens except: - Answer✔Neisseria gonorrhoeae
What is the best method of recovery of anaerobic bacteria from a deep abscess?
-Cotton Fiber swab of abscess area
-Skin snip of surface tissue
-Needle aspirate after surface decontamination
-Swab of the scalpel used for debridement - Answer✔Needle aspirate after surface
decontamination
What is the primary and differential media of choice for recovery of most fecal pathogens? -
Answer✔Hekotoen, MacConkey, Campy, colistin-nalidixic acid (CNA) agars
What is the media of choice for recovery of Vibrio cholerae from a stool specimen? -
Answer✔Thiosulfate-citrate-bile-sucrose (TCBS) agar and alkaline peptone water (APW) broth
